What Preparations Should You Undertake Before Cutting Your Lawn?
Properly preparing your lawn is essential before mowing. Clearing away debris such as leaves, branches, and toys allows mowers to operate effectively, reducing the risk of equipment damage. This preparation ensures a level finish across the lawn, enhancing the visual appeal and charm of your garden.
It is crucial to check for hidden obstacles like stones or garden ornaments to protect both the mower and the lawn. Taking these precautions minimises the risk of accidents and allows for a more efficient cutting process, leading to a healthier lawn in Haselbury Plucknett.
How Can You Ensure Safety While Operating Lawn Cutting Equipment?
Prioritising safety when using lawn cutting equipment is vital. Before starting, inspect the sharpness of the blades and the fuel levels. These simple checks significantly reduce the risk of accidents during operation. Dull blades can tear grass rather than providing a clean cut, which may weaken the lawn.
Wearing appropriate protective gear, such as gloves, goggles, and sturdy footwear, protects operators from common hazards. Given the typical conditions in Haselbury Plucknett, being well-prepared greatly enhances the likelihood of a safe and effective grass cutting experience.

What is the Recommended Mowing Frequency for UK Lawns?
For optimal lawn health, it is advisable to mow every 7 to 10 days during peak growth seasons. This frequency helps maintain the ideal grass height, fostering healthy growth and preventing overgrowth. Adjusting mowing intervals based on rainfall patterns is crucial; wetter conditions may require more frequent cuts.
In Haselbury Plucknett, being mindful of local weather conditions can assist residents in effectively timing their mowing sessions. Keeping an eye on the forecast ensures that grass is cut at the appropriate times, maximising health and visual appeal.

How Should You Adjust Your Mowing During Dry Spells?
During dry weather, it is advisable to reduce mowing frequency to retain moisture in the turf. Cutting grass too short under hot conditions can stress the plants, making them more susceptible to drought. Opting for early-morning mowing sessions minimises stress on the grass, aiding in better recovery.
In Haselbury Plucknett, adjusting mowing practices to accommodate dry conditions helps ensure that lawns remain healthy. This approach preserves the lush appearance of grass while protecting it from the adverse effects of prolonged heat.
How to Manage Leaf Accumulation in Autumn?
As autumn approaches, fallen leaves can threaten lawn health if not managed properly. Timely removal of leaves prevents suffocation and reduces the risk of disease, allowing grass to receive adequate sunlight and air circulation. Combining leaf clearance with final cuts prepares lawns for the winter months ahead.
In Haselbury Plucknett, residents should plan a thorough clean-up before winter arrives. This practice not only safeguards the lawn but also enhances the visual appeal of gardens during the autumn season.
What Challenges Does Winter Weather Present for Lawn Care?
Winter in Haselbury Plucknett brings unique challenges for lawn maintenance. Avoiding cuts on frosty or waterlogged ground is essential to prevent damage to grass blades and soil compaction. Mowing under these conditions can cause long-term harm, affecting grass health when spring returns.
Delaying mowing until conditions thaw and dry helps ensure that lawns can regrow healthily once milder weather returns. Understanding seasonal challenges allows residents to adjust their lawn care practices accordingly.

What Practical Steps Can You Take for Successful Mowing?
To achieve effective mowing, it is vital to follow height guidelines specific to local grass varieties. Generally, maintaining grass height between 2.5 and 4 inches is recommended to encourage healthy growth. Avoid cutting more than one-third of the grass height in one go to prevent unnecessary stress on the plants.
Ensuring that mower blades are sharp enhances the quality of the cut. A clean cut reduces the risk of disease and facilitates quicker healing. Regular equipment maintenance is equally important for achieving the best results during grass cutting in Haselbury Plucknett.
How Can You Avoid Common Lawn Care Mistakes?
A common error in lawn care is overcutting, which can weaken turf and encourage increased weed growth. Cutting grass too short exposes the soil to sunlight, prompting weed seed germination. This practice can create long-term challenges for maintaining a healthy lawn.
Failing to consider weather conditions can also result in uneven cuts and grass damage. Being aware of local climate factors is crucial for achieving consistent results in Haselbury Plucknett. Adjusting mowing practices to align with weather conditions ensures healthier lawns and improved aesthetics.
What Expert Advice Is Available for Effective Weed Control?
Weed control is a vital aspect of maintaining a pristine lawn. Early identification of troublesome weed species allows for targeted treatments that can prevent them from taking over. Regular mowing also assists in managing weeds by inhibiting their flowering and seeding.
Applying treatments when necessary, such as selective herbicides, can further enhance lawn health. An expert analysis of weed control methods tailored to Haselbury Plucknett‘s unique conditions ensures that residents can effectively and sustainably maintain their gardens.

What Are the Watering Guidelines After Mowing?
After mowing, light irrigation supports recovery without the risk of waterlogging. Timing watering sessions for early evening is optimal, as it aligns with Haselbury Plucknett‘s climate patterns. This method allows grass to absorb moisture efficiently while minimising evaporation.
Avoiding heavy watering immediately after mowing helps prevent stress on the grass. Instead, a light misting can offer necessary hydration for healthy regrowth. Following these guidelines ensures that lawns remain vibrant and lush throughout the growing season.
How Often Should You Apply Fertiliser?
Applying fertiliser is crucial for supporting vigorous regrowth in lawns. A balanced fertiliser should be administered every six weeks during the growing season to provide essential nutrients. Conducting soil tests beforehand ensures that the appropriate products are chosen, optimising lawn health.
In Haselbury Plucknett, being mindful of local soil conditions helps residents select the most suitable fertiliser. This tailored approach enhances the effectiveness of fertilisation efforts, resulting in a healthier and more resilient lawn.
What Are the Benefits of Lawn Aeration?
Aerating the lawn is an important practice that alleviates compaction and improves air and water flow to the roots. This process enhances overall lawn health by promoting deeper root growth and better nutrient uptake. Performing aeration annually can yield substantial benefits for lawns in Haselbury Plucknett.
By creating small holes in the soil, aeration facilitates the exchange of gases and moisture, which is essential for healthy grass. This practice not only boosts the resilience of lawns but also significantly contributes to their overall beauty and vitality.
Frequently Asked Questions About Lawn Care
How often should I mow my grass in Haselbury Plucknett?
Mowing your grass every seven to ten days during peak growth periods is advisable to maintain optimal health and appearance.
What is the best time of day to mow?
Mowing in the early morning or late afternoon is ideal, as temperatures are cooler and grass experiences less stress.
Should I collect my grass clippings?
Leaving grass clippings on the lawn can provide nutrients as they decompose, but if they are too long, it is better to collect them to prevent smothering.
How can I enhance my lawn’s soil health?
Regular aeration, appropriate watering, and the application of organic fertilisers can significantly improve your lawn’s soil health, promoting robust growth.
What type of mower is best for my lawn?
A rotary mower is suitable for most lawns, while a reel mower may be effective for smaller, well-maintained areas. Choose based on your lawn size and condition.
How can I prevent weeds in my lawn?
Regular mowing, proper watering, and targeted herbicide application can help prevent weed growth. Early identification and treatment are crucial for maintaining a healthy lawn.
Is it worth hiring professionals for grass cutting?
Yes, employing professionals can save time and ensure quality care, leading to healthier lawns and potentially higher property values over time.
What should I do if my lawn becomes waterlogged?
Refrain from mowing until the ground dries out. Aeration and improving drainage can help prevent waterlogging in the future.
How can I tell if my lawn needs fertiliser?
Signs that your lawn requires fertiliser include yellowing grass, slow growth, and sparse patches. Regular soil testing can help identify nutrient deficiencies.
Can I cut my grass too short?
Yes, cutting grass too short can weaken it, making it more susceptible to disease and weeds. Aim to cut no more than one-third of the grass height in a single session.
